Building function loss evaluated with hazard consistent ground motions, 2; Influence of correlation on damage

Sakamoto, Shigehiro*; Igarashi, Sayaka*; Nishida, Akemi  ; Muramatsu, Ken; Takada, Tsuyoshi*  

This paper is intended to clarify the difference of building function loss possibilities which depend on the realization way of the variation and/or inter-period correlation in the response spectra of ground motions. The authors prepared some cases of GMs sets shown in following. The response analyses of a simple RC structure were conducted for each cases and the damage frequencies of equipment system were compared. case(n): simulated GMs which have no variation in response spectra. case(p): simulated GMs which have the same variation in response spectra with case(r), while the inter-period correlation coefficient is 1.0.. case(c): simulated GMs which the same variation with case(r) and the modeled inter-period correlation of case(r) in the response spectra. where, case(r) is the set of original ground motions.
